The instruction description says "It is loaded without rounding
errors." which implies we should have the widest rounding mode
possible.

diff --git a/target/i386/tcg/fpu_helper.c b/target/i386/tcg/fpu_helper.c
index cdd8e9f947..d986fd5792 100644
--- a/target/i386/tcg/fpu_helper.c
+++ b/target/i386/tcg/fpu_helper.c
@@ -250,11 +250,15 @@ void helper_fildl_ST0(CPUX86State *env, int32_t val)
 void helper_fildll_ST0(CPUX86State *env, int64_t val)
 {
     int new_fpstt;
+    FloatX80RoundPrec old = get_floatx80_rounding_precision(&env->fp_status);
+    set_floatx80_rounding_precision(floatx80_precision_x, &env->fp_status);
 
     new_fpstt = (env->fpstt - 1) & 7;
     env->fpregs[new_fpstt].d = int64_to_floatx80(val, &env->fp_status);
     env->fpstt = new_fpstt;
     env->fptags[new_fpstt] = 0; /* validate stack entry */
+
+    set_floatx80_rounding_precision(old, &env->fp_status);
 }
